McCain ponders Peddlers prep

DONALD McCAIN is keeping his fingers crossed his Champion Hurdle hope Peddlers Cross will still be able to make a racecourse appearance before Cheltenham after a setback ruled him out of this weekend’s engagements.

The Fighting Fifth Hurdle winner missed his intended Champion Hurdle prep race at Haydock last month after the meeting was abandoned and he was due to line up at either Ffos Las or Sandown tomorrow.

However, after coughing on Wednesday morning, McCain ruled the unbeaten six-year-old out of both races and he could now be rerouted to Kelso’s Morebattle Hurdle or the Kingwell Hurdle at Wincanton later this month.
